# 在 Linux 上配置 Cursor AI 编辑器:AppImage 安装与桌面快捷方式创建指南
Cursor 是一款强大的 AI 辅助代码编辑器,提供了许多智能功能。对于 Linux 用户,AppImage 是一种便捷的安装方式,它允许你在不安装系统依赖的情况下运行应用程序。本文将详细指导你如何在 Linux 系统上安装 Cursor AppImage,并创建桌面快捷方式,解决常见的 “不信任的桌面文件” 和图标不显示问题。
# 准备工作
在开始之前,请确保你已经下载了 Cursor 的 AppImage 文件。通常,它会命名为 Cursor-X.Y.Z-x86_64.AppImage
(其中 X.Y.Z 是版本号)。
假设:
- 你的 Cursor AppImage 文件位于
~/下载/Cursor-1.2.2-x86_64.AppImage
。 - 你选择的图标文件(例如
1.png
)位于~/图片/1.png
。 - 你的 Linux 用户名为
c
。 - 你的桌面目录是
~/桌面
(中文)。
# 步骤 1:赋予 AppImage 文件执行权限
AppImage 文件下载后默认是没有执行权限的,你需要手动添加。
打开终端(通常通过
Ctrl + Alt + T
快捷键)。进入 AppImage 所在的目录:
Bash
1
cd ~/下载/
赋予 AppImage 文件执行权限:
Bash
1
chmod +x Cursor-1.2.2-x86_64.AppImage
(请根据你实际的文件名修改
Cursor-1.2.2-x86_64.AppImage
)
# 步骤 2:安装 FUSE 库(如果缺少)
Cursor AppImage 依赖于 FUSE (Filesystem in Userspace) 库来运行。如果你的系统缺少它,直接运行 AppImage 会报错 error loading libfuse.so.2
。
更新软件包列表:
Bash
1
sudo apt update
安装
libfuse2
:Bash
1
sudo apt install libfuse2
在执行
sudo
命令时,系统会提示你输入用户密码。
# 步骤 3:准备图标文件(并确保格式正确)
.desktop
文件通常期望图标是 PNG ( .png
) 或 SVG ( .svg
) 格式。如果你使用的是 JPEG ( .jpg
) 格式的图片,可能会导致图标无法显示。
将你的图标文件放置到方便管理的目录,例如~/ 图片 /。
假设你的图标文件名为 1.png,完整路径为 /home/c/ 图片 / 1.png。
如果你的图标是 JPEG 格式(例如 1.jpg),强烈建议将其转换为 PNG 格式:
a. 安装 imagemagick 工具:
Bash
1
sudo apt install imagemagick
b. 转换图片格式:
Bash
1
convert "/home/c/图片/1.jpg" "/home/c/图片/1.png"
(请将路径和文件名替换为你的实际情况)
# 步骤 4:创建 .desktop
桌面快捷方式文件
.desktop
文件是 Linux 桌面环境识别应用程序的配置文件。
打开终端。
创建一个新的
.desktop
文件: 建议将其放在用户私有的应用程序快捷方式标准位置~/.local/share/applications/
。Bash
1
gedit ~/.local/share/applications/cursor.desktop
(如果你没有
gedit
,可以使用nano
或vi
等其他文本编辑器)将以下内容粘贴到编辑器中,并根据你的实际情况进行修改:
Ini, TOML
1
2
3
4
5
6
7
8
9
10
11[Desktop Entry]
Type=Application
Name=Cursor AI Editor
Comment=AI-powered code editor
Exec="/home/c/下载/Cursor-1.2.2-x86_64.AppImage" # <-- 确保这里是AppImage的完整绝对路径
Icon=/home/c/图片/1.png # <-- 确保这里是图标文件的完整绝对路径
Terminal=false
Categories=Development;TextEditor;IDE;
StartupNotify=true
StartupWMClass=Cursor
MimeType=text/plain;text/x-chdr;text/x-csrc;text/x-c++hdr;text/x-c++src;text/x-java;text/x-dsrc;text/x-pascal;text/x-perl;text/x-python;application/x-php;application/x-httpd-php3;application/x-httpd-php4;application/x-httpd-php5;application/javascript;application/json;text/css;text/html;text/xml;重要提示:
Exec=
行:请务必填写你的 Cursor AppImage 文件的完整绝对路径。为了避免路径中包含空格或特殊字符引起的问题,建议用双引号包裹整个路径。Icon=
行:请务必填写你的图标文件的完整绝对路径。
保存并关闭文件。
# 步骤 5:将快捷方式复制到桌面并赋予信任权限
为了让桌面环境显示并信任这个快捷方式,你需要将其复制到桌面并赋予执行权限。
复制
.desktop
文件到桌面:Bash
1
cp ~/.local/share/applications/cursor.desktop ~/桌面/
(请注意,你的桌面目录可能是中文的
桌面
,而不是英文的Desktop
)赋予桌面上的 .desktop 文件执行权限:
这是最关键的一步,它告诉系统这是一个可执行的程序启动器。
方法一(推荐,图形界面):
- 右键点击桌面上的
cursor.desktop
文件。 - 选择 "属性" (Properties)。
- 切换到 "权限" (Permissions) 标签页。
- 勾选 "允许作为程序执行文件" (Allow executing file as program) 选项。
- 点击 "关闭" 或 "确定"。
- 右键点击桌面上的
方法二(命令行):
Bash
1
chmod +x ~/桌面/cursor.desktop
# 步骤 6:刷新桌面环境
修改 .desktop
文件和权限后,桌面环境通常不会立即更新其显示。
- 注销(Log Out)你的用户会话,然后重新登录。 这是最可靠的刷新方式。
- 或者,重启你的虚拟机。
# 最终验证
完成以上所有步骤并刷新桌面后:
- 你的
~/桌面/
目录下应该会出现一个带有你指定图标的Cursor AI Editor
快捷方式。 - 双击这个桌面图标,Cursor AI 编辑器应该能够成功启动。
希望这份详细的教程能帮助到你和其他 Linux 用户!